Shubham Karmakar

Senior Software Engineer

Bengaluru, Karnataka, India7 yrs 7 mos experience
Most Likely To Switch

Key Highlights

  • Expert in microservices architecture and AWS.
  • Proficient in building high-performing APIs with Node.js.
  • Strong background in MongoDB and data aggregation.
Stackforce AI infers this person is a Full Stack Developer specializing in AI and Cloud-based solutions.

Contact

Skills

Core Skills

Full Stack DevelopmentBackend Development

Other Skills

API DevelopmentAngularJSCSS3Data Structure DesignDistributed LoggingExpress.jsFrontend DevelopmentJWTMongoDBNoSQL Schema DesignNode.jsRESTful APIsRESTful Web Services

About

Software Engineer with experience in building scalable backend systems using microservices architecture and leveraging the beauty of cloud services provided by AWS. Experience in working with fast changing data and writing performant queries in MongoDB. Highly skilled in building RESTfull API's using Node.js. I am specialized in : - Microservice Architecture - Back-end Development in Node.JS - Writing high performing queries in MongoDB - Writing serverless code using AWS lambda - Seamless deployment using Jenkins

Experience

7-eleven global solution center – india

Senior Software Engineer

Jul 2023Present · 2 yrs 8 mos · Bengaluru, Karnataka, India · On-site

Anko

Software Engineer

May 2021Jul 2023 · 2 yrs 2 mos · Bengaluru, Karnataka, India · On-site

Cognitifai

Full Stack Engineer

Aug 2018May 2021 · 2 yrs 9 mos · Bengaluru, Karnataka, India

  • 1. Worked closely with the AI team for designing data structure to communicate between the Machine Learning Models and Web Products.
  • 2. Worked in the platform team to build Frontend components using React and Typescript and build API's and backend libraries using Python and Nodejs
  • 3. Distributed logging across microservices
  • 4. Built Dashboards for Realtime AI data
  • 5. Was responsible for aggregating huge amount of data in MongoDB
  • 6. Was responsible for writing CRON jobs in NodeJs
Data Structure DesignFrontend DevelopmentAPI DevelopmentDistributed LoggingMongoDBNode.js+2

Fimseb technology pvt. ltd

Full Stack Developer (Internship)

Feb 2018Apr 2018 · 2 mos · Greater Delhi Area

  • Responsible for building backend and creating Restful Web Services using Node with Express and integrating payment module into the system for a fundraising/charity website.
  • Back-end Developing in Node.JS & Express JS: Built the backend using Node and Express following the feature based folder structure and best Javascript practices. Added payment integration and Restful API’s to perform CRUD operations on Campaigns and Charities. Secured the API’s using JWT.
  • Teamwork and Good Presentation Skill: Worked with a team of 8 members. Was responsible for planning and communicating with and Backend and Frontend team and occasionally helding presentation in skype.
  • Programming in Javascript: Was responsible for adding interactivity to the frontend pages and making AJAX request from the front-end and optimizing the speed and performance of the web pages.
Backend DevelopmentRESTful Web ServicesNode.jsExpress.jsJWT

Tech genie delhi

Full-stack Developer - Internship

Jan 2018Mar 2018 · 2 mos · Greater Delhi Area

  • Responsible for Designing, Planning and Building the front-end and back-end for a product called Hotel Genie that had to be responsive and specially optimized for mobile devices.
  • NoSql Schema Design: Designed the Schema for food and beverage menu and also payment model for different Restaurants offered by Hotel Genie.
  • Back-end Developing in Node.JS & Express JS: Built the back-end using Node and Express following the feature based folder structure and best Javascript practices. Added payment integration, designed and implemented RESTFUL API’s to perform CRUD operations on Food and Beverage items. Responsible for sending emails once order is placed.
  • Front-end Development: Developed a single page front-end application using AngularJS and was responsible to build a real time cart page and calculating taxes and GST on adding and removing items in real time. Responsible for compressing image size before uploading to the server.
  • Web Technologies: Developed responsive web pages with minimalist design and perfect color and icon combination using CSS3 techniques like flexbox and Bootstrap.
NoSQL Schema DesignBackend DevelopmentRESTful APIsAngularJSCSS3Full Stack Development

Education

Dibrugarh University

Bachelor's degree — Computer Science

Jan 2015Jan 2018

Stackforce found 100+ more professionals with Full Stack Development & Backend Development

Explore similar profiles based on matching skills and experience